Senior Manager, eCommerce (SEC/CONTRACT) – Liquor Control Board of Ontario – Toronto, ON

Company: Liquor Control Board of Ontario

Location: Toronto, ON

Expected salary: $76953 – 138559 per year

Job date: Sun, 03 Nov 2024 04:32:22 GMT

Job description: Location Address: 100 Queens Quay East, 9th Floor, TorontoNumber of Openings: 1Pay $76,953.00 – $138,559.00Job Posting Description:This is a hybrid role #LI-HybridSecondment/Contract Duration: Up to 16 MonthsAre you passionate about ecommerce, customer experiences and product development? As Sr. Manager, eCommerce Product, you will support the Director and will be entrusted with driving the evolution of our digital web experiences. You will work in close collaboration with the ecommerce, operations, merchandising, marketing and analytic teams to understand and deliver on the strategic big picture, while inherently and independently being detail-oriented, organized and driven to identify and produce efforts related to product features, design and roadmap required to put that picture together.If you are an innovative and a strategic problem solver who is passionate about improving customer experiences, then this is the role for you!About the Role

  • Partner with internal and external stakeholders to release world-class features and functionality, measure the success of products and strategize iterative improvements.
  • Leverage metrics and customer-focused data, alongside industry best practice and your own research to continually identify growth opportunities to improve the customer journey.
  • Explore the latest ecommerce trends and features and how they could apply within our digital experiences.
  • Work across the organization to understand feature prioritization, determine sprint capacity, and plan sprints.
  • Collaborate on release management, including writing and distributing product briefs and managing releases.
  • Participate in daily agile rituals like scrum, backlog grooming, sprint planning, and retrospective with a cross-functional team.
  • Monitor the progress of tickets, clear blockers, and answer business/product questions for the development team and internal business stakeholders.

About You

  • Post-secondary education in Computer Science, Marketing, Business, eCommerce, or related program.
  • 7+ years experience in product management, business analyst, or similar role.
  • 2+ years product management experience focused on building strong web experiences.
  • Demonstrated success managing and improving existing products with Agile/Scrum methodologies and prototyping tools.
  • Strong written and verbal skills to communicate with technical partners, peers, and executive management alike clearly and effectively.
  • Ability to write clear and thorough specifications and user stories.
  • Ability to constructively give and receive criticism.
  • Flexibility to adapt to changing requirements and priorities.
  • A sense of urgency and a drive to exceed expectations with a positive, can-do mindset.
  • Ideas for the future of retail and wholesale.
